Arizona Oncology provides a “Patient Benefits Representative” (“PBR”) to serve as your financial counselor and provide education about insurance benefits. Your PBR will explain the total cost of the planned treatment, your out-of-pocket expense, the practice’s payment policies, and evaluate for additional financial resources.
As our practice policy, please be aware of your responsibilities for the following:
- Referrals - Obtaining current referrals as required by your insurance carrier.
- Personal Information - Notifying our office of changes regarding your personal or insurance information.
- Current Balances - Are due at the time of your visit.
- Deductible - A deductible is the amount you pay for health care services before your health insurance begins to pay.
- Coinsurance - Coinsurance is your share of the costs of a health care service. It’s usually figured as a percentage of the amount your insurance allows to be charged for services. You start paying coinsurance after you’ve paid your plan’s deductible.
- Co-payments - This is a fixed amount you pay for a health care service.
- Financial Assistance - Contact a patient benefit representative (“PBR”) to review the qualifications and your eligibility.
